Introduction
The Remote Sensing for Telecom Network Planning and Deployment Training Course equips professionals with advanced skills to utilize remote sensing and geospatial technologies for planning, deploying, and optimizing modern telecommunications networks. The course combines theory, practical applications, and real-world case studies to ensure participants can translate spatial data into actionable deployment strategies.
Telecommunications networks require precise spatial analysis to achieve optimal coverage, capacity, and quality of service. This course demonstrates how satellite imagery, LiDAR, and multispectral data can be integrated into GIS platforms to support evidence-based network planning and strategic infrastructure deployment.
Participants will learn how to process, interpret, and apply remote sensing data for site selection, line-of-sight evaluation, and terrain analysis. The course emphasizes hands-on application, enabling participants to make informed decisions that improve operational efficiency and reduce network rollout risks.
The training bridges technical remote sensing knowledge with planning and management competencies. It highlights how geospatial intelligence can support digital transformation in telecommunications, facilitate smart city integration, and enable effective monitoring of network infrastructure performance.
Emerging topics such as 5G deployment, broadband expansion, IoT-enabled networks, and sustainable infrastructure planning are embedded throughout the course. Participants will gain insight into leveraging remote sensing to optimize network performance while ensuring compliance with regulatory and environmental standards.
By the end of the course, participants will be fully equipped to implement remote sensing and GIS-based strategies to optimize network deployment. They will be capable of analyzing coverage, monitoring infrastructure, and applying spatial intelligence to improve telecom network efficiency, reliability, and sustainability.

Comprehensive Course Outline

Module 1: Introduction to Remote Sensing for Telecoms

  • Fundamentals of remote sensing technology
  • Types of satellite imagery and data sources
  • Applications in telecom network planning
  • Integration with GIS platforms

Module 2: Geospatial Data Acquisition and Management

  • Sources of geospatial and satellite data
  • Preprocessing and data correction techniques
  • Data management and storage
  • Quality assurance and validation

Module 3: Terrain and Line-of-Sight Analysis

  • Digital elevation models for telecom planning
  • Line-of-sight and obstruction analysis
  • Terrain-based network design
  • Site selection strategies

Module 4: Signal Coverage and Propagation Analysis

  • Radio frequency propagation principles
  • Coverage mapping and gap identification
  • Optimization of antenna and tower locations
  • Signal quality and interference mitigation

Module 5: 5G and Broadband Network Planning

  • Remote sensing for 5G site selection
  • Broadband infrastructure coverage planning
  • Integration with IoT and smart devices
  • Deployment optimization techniques

Module 6: LiDAR and Multispectral Data Applications

  • LiDAR for precision mapping
  • Multispectral imagery interpretation
  • Combining multiple datasets for planning
  • Hands-on remote sensing exercises

Module 7: Monitoring and Maintenance of Networks

  • Infrastructure performance monitoring
  • Predictive maintenance using spatial analytics
  • Fault detection and reporting
  • Network performance dashboards

Module 8: Smart City and IoT Integration

  • GIS-enabled smart city telecom planning
  • IoT and sensor-based network monitoring
  • Multi-source data integration for urban networks
  • Digital twin concepts for telecom networks

Module 9: Policy, Governance, and Investment Planning

  • Remote sensing for regulatory compliance
  • Investment prioritization using geospatial data
  • Reporting and stakeholder engagement
  • Evidence-based policy support

Module 10: Applied Projects and Case Studies

  • Real-world telecom network planning case studies
  • Hands-on deployment and coverage exercises
  • Group spatial analysis projects
  • Development of actionable remote sensing plans
